Frequently Asked Questions About Assisted Living in Colburn
Common questions families have when exploring assisted living options in Colburn, Idaho.
What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Colburn, Idaho?
The average monthly cost for assisted living in Colburn, Idaho, typically ranges from $3,500 to $5,000, depending on the level of care, room type, and amenities. This is generally lower than the national average, reflecting the cost of living in rural Idaho. It's important to contact local facilities directly for precise pricing and to inquire about any financial assistance programs available in the state.

How are assisted living facilities regulated and licensed in Idaho, specifically for the Colburn area?
All assisted living facilities in Idaho, including those serving the Colburn area, are licensed and regulated by the Idaho Department of Health and Welfare. They must comply with state rules covering resident care, staff training, safety standards, and facility inspections. Families can verify a facility's license status and review inspection reports through the Department's website or by contacting their local office.
What local resources are available in Idaho to help seniors in Colburn transition to assisted living?
Seniors and their families in the Colburn area can access resources through the Idaho Commission on Aging (ICOA), which serves the region. The ICOA offers options counseling, assistance with benefit programs, and information on long-term care. Additionally, local Area Agencies on Aging, such as the one covering Idaho County, can provide referrals, caregiver support, and help navigating the transition to an assisted living facility in a nearby community.
